Virtu Financial, Inc. Q4 FY2025 earnings call

January 29, 2026 · fiscal period ended 2025-12

EPS · actual vs est

$1.85 / $1.28Beat +44.5%

Revenue · actual vs est

$969.9M / $526.4MBeat +84.2%

Management highlights

  • Focus on growth through investing in infrastructure, acquiring talent, and expanding capital base.
  • Fourth quarter results positively impacted by favorable operating environment. Incremental capital added and its dynamic deployment had a meaningful impact.
  • VES had a record quarter with accelerating client engagement, new clients onboarding, and existing clients doing more business across all products, brokerage, algos, venues, workflow analytics, and all geographies.
  • Increased invested capital by $625 million in 2025, with $448 million in the second half, generating an average return of 100% over the year.
  • Full year 2025 cash compensation ratio was 19%, within historical range, reflecting focus on retaining and acquiring top talent.

Segment performance

For the fourth quarter of 2025, Market Making reported adjusted net trading income (ANTI) of $7.8 million per day, and for the full year 2025, it was $6.7 million per day. Virtu Execution Services (VES) reached $2 million per day in the quarter and $1.9 million per day for the full year. Both segments benefited from favorable market conditions, elevated volumes, and strong execution by the team.

Guidance

  • Continue to expand capital base, strengthen infrastructure, and deploy capital where greatest opportunities are seen.
  • Maintain quarterly dividend of $0.24 per share.
  • Long-term goal of being through the cycle at $10 million per day.

Risks

  • Uncertainties in new markets or asset classes due to potential lack of perfect regulatory or legal certainty.
  • Market conditions affecting the ability to deploy capital, with possible quarters where buffers are greater if opportunities aren't present.

Q&A highlights

Q: The dollar value of your 605 quoted spreads looked like it declined sequentially. So is it fair for us to conclude that this quarter's strong performance came from areas outside of equities, and if so, can you provide some granularity on which asset classes were the largest contributors to your sequential growth?

A: It's about the favorable operating environment with higher volatility, up VIX, up equity share volumes, and drivers like asset rotation, fixed income, currencies, commodities. We're a scaled global firm not just retail flow, VES had a record quarter with all businesses performing well across products and geographies.

Q: Production markets, obviously, it seems like hey take an even larger role in the headlines every day. Can you give us your updated thoughts on participating in the asset class and whether sports or non-sports contracts would represent a more attractive entry point in the space?

A: We're optimistic about new markets but being careful due to regulatory/legal uncertainties. Evaluating how markets shake out, some markets more similar to current trading, with market making activities like cross-exchange arbitrage to investigate.

Q: You mentioned you deployed incremental capital during the quarter. Can you give us a sense of the magnitude of the incremental capital that you did deploy. And as we look to the coming quarters, if market conditions are accommodative, what is the magnitude of incremental capital that you could deploy if you so chose?

A: Total increase in trading capital from 2024 to 2025 was over $600 million, $450 million in the second half. Deployed pretty much all of it, but maintain buffers in regulated entities. Long term, with historical returns, expect to deploy more capital through organic growth and prudent borrowings depending on quarters.
